Top definition
noun A crazy stalker girl who goes for older men. She will cling like a leech and won't accept no. Beware of this chick.
"Oh my god that Talula girl is asking Ryan out again."

"This will be a fun year..."
by Fsfhurdvjoo1111 February 23, 2017
Get the mug
Get a Talula mug for your guy G√ľnter.
A dog that a typical old IB TOK teacher owns. Usually brought into the classroom at a deathly hour of 7 am every Wednesday. This dog has a tendency to crap on the floor and the rest of the students suffer the aroma whilst in the same room.
Ew! Ms. Kinegal brought in Talula again and she closed the door on us.
by kleaie February 17, 2005
Get the mug
Get a talula mug for your barber Manafort.